Sunday 25th May – Windsurf ** River Orwell at Levington – sunny periods and showers.

Foil – 18.66 knot max, 16.50 knot ave., 7.42 knot hour, 14.23 knot mile, 27.80 km., 13.73 knot alpha.

Starboard Freeride 150 and a Evolution Freeride foil with a Tushingham Storm 5.2.

With the wind forecast to be westerly my go to venue is the River Orwell at Levington, my visit there since 13th April! Arrived at the marina in lovely sunshine and things looked good with the wind gusting over 20 knots but sadly not a great direction for here wsw:( Robert arrived and we both rigged sails around 5.2 but by the time we launched the sun had disappeared. I did fly straight off the beach but the session went down hill as it was very lumpy and gusty, no sail would have been right today, one minute you were overpowered the next you were floundering along, it even rained on us! I did make it down to the dock once but westerly would have been much better! After a couple of hours playing hunt the gust I had had enough and called it a day. I had time to shower and pack up before Mag arrived on her bike with lunch! A few days of wind coming but wsw again tomorrow so not sure what to do?
